Academic FAQs

Common questions about our academic programs

It is a flexible curriculum that follows Anna University regulations, allowing students to choose from a wide range of professional and open elective subjects based on their personal interests and career goals.

Performance is measured through Outcome-Based Education (OBE), focusing on specific learning objectives (Course Outcomes). Evaluation includes three Continuous Internal Assessment Tests (CIAT) per semester and final end-semester examinations conducted by the University.

Yes, the college provides a 100% internship guarantee and promotes industry-based learning to ensure graduates are job-ready.

The CBCS framework allows for inter-disciplinary skill development by choosing elective courses from different departments to bridge gaps in the standard syllabus.

Undergraduate students are encouraged to work on live industry projects and are mentored by the Research Committee to publish their final-year projects in reputed journals indexed in SCOPUS or UGC CARE.

Students are assigned dedicated faculty mentors who provide personalized attention, career counseling, and academic advice. This system maintains a low student-to-faculty ratio of approximately 15:1.

Each student is expected to earn 100% attendance by attending all classes. While the university may have specific minimums (typically 75%), the college strictly enforces discipline, and missing institutional tests is dealt with seriously.
